A HOUSE RESOLUTION

TO CONGRATULATE MR. JERRY R. PRICE OF LEXINGTON WHO IS THE NEW POSTMASTER OF THE LEXINGTON POST OFFICE AND TO WISH HIM WELL IN THIS POSITION.

Whereas, Mr. Jerry R. Price of Lexington is the new postmaster of the Lexington Post Office; and

Whereas, he was superintendent of postal operations at the Cayce-West Columbia Post Office from January, 1988, until March, 1991; and

Whereas, a graduate of Lexington High School, Mr. Price has worked in the postal service in the Columbia area since 1962. He began as a distribution clerk and served as an accounting technician in budget operations, and as manager of budget and cost before moving up to the Cayce-West Columbia Post Office; and

Whereas, the members of the House of Representatives desire to recognize Mr. Price for his many years of dedicated service to his community. Now, therefore,

Be it resolved by the House of Representatives:

That the members of the House of Representatives congratulate Mr. Jerry R. Price of Lexington who is the new Postmaster of the Lexington Post Office and wish him well in this position.

Be it further resolved that a copy of this resolution be forwarded to Mr. Price.
